The Project Management Institute (PMI) has announced the development of a new credential in the area of portfolio management. Based on encouragement from industry leaders and extensive market research with project, program and portfolio management practitioners, hiring managers, and other key stakeholders, the PMI is ready to move forward with this credential.
This credential is currently under development as part of PMI’s Phase Gate process and it is anticipated that the new credential will begin with a pilot at the end of 2013.
The Portfolio Management Professional (PfMP)SM credential will be role-based and will require successfully demonstrating experience and education, as well as passing an exam and completing a multi-tier evaluation. Ongoing professional development will be required in order to maintain the credential. Since the focus of portfolio management is centered on the more advanced concept of aligning the investment of projects/programs with organizational strategy, this credential will be targeted for a seasoned practitioner, who has four to seven years of project portfolio management experience and at least eight to ten years of general business experience.

*PMI acknowledges that project portfolio management is an emerging practice and there may not be as many educational/training opportunities in this area. As a result, portfolio management education contact hours will not be a requirement for eligibility.
PMI plan to formally start accepting pilot phase applications in October 2013 and plan to administer the first exam for the pilot by the end of December 2013. The full launch of the credential will likely be in the second quarter of 2014.
